Keith O’Brien: disgraced ex-cardinal dies after fall

Britain’s former most senior Catholic cleric resigned in 2013 after admitting to sexual misconduct

Cardinal Keith O’Brien, formerly the Catholic Church’s most senior cleric in Britain, has died at the age of 80.

O’Brien, who stepped down as Archbishop of St Andrews and Edinburgh in 2013 after admitting to sexual misconduct, suffered a broken collarbone and a head injury in a fall last month, The Scotsman reports.
